Combined activity of natural products and the fungal entomopathogen Cordyceps farinosa against Bagrada hilaris (Hemiptera: Pentatomidae)
Abstract
The invasive painted bug, Bagrada hilaris (Burmeister) (Hemiptera: Pentatomidae) is causing important losses in Brassica production. The main tool for management of this insect is the use of synthetic insecticides. There is an urgent need to find efficacious and environmentally friendly alternatives for its management. In this work, natural products (neem and lemongrass oils, and the microbial derivative spinosad) were tested separately and in combination with suspensions of infective conidia of the entomopathogenic fungus Cordyceps farinosa (Holmsk.) Kepler, Shrestha & Spatafora (Hypocreales: Cordycipitaceae) (strain ARSEF 13507) in the laboratory. The application of C. farinosa alone caused significant mortality. Regarding individual natural products, the highest mortality was obtained with spinosad. Neem oil alone caused low, non-significant mortality, and lemongrass oil alone caused low, marginally significant mortality. Both oils in combination with C. farinosa resulted in antagonistic effects, compared with the fungus alone. The combination of C. farinosa with spinosad resulted in increased insect mortality (20% and higher) compared with the separate agents. Our results indicate that spinosad (a high-price insecticide) should be tested in reduced amounts and combined with C. farinosa or possibly other entomopathogenic fungi, for control of painted bugs.
Resumen
La chinche pintada Bagrada hilaris (Burmeister) (Hemiptera: Pentatomidae) es un insecto invasor que causa pérdidas importantes en la producción de Brassica. La principal herramienta para su manejo es el control con insecticidas sintéticos. Urge encontrar alternativas eficaces y respetuosas con el medio ambiente para su manejo. En este trabajo, los productos naturales (aceites de neem y zacate limón o limoncillo, y el derivado microbiano spinosad) se probaron por separado y en combinación con suspensiones de conidias infectivas del hongo entomopatógeno Cordyceps farinosa (Holmsk.) Kepler, Shrestha & Spatafora (Hypocreales: Cordycipitaceae) (aislamiento ARSEF 13507) en el laboratorio. La aplicación de C. farinosa sola provocó mortalidad significativa. Con respecto a los productos naturales individuales, la mayor mortalidad se obtuvo con spinosad. El aceite de neem por sí solo causó mortalidad baja, no significativa y el de limncillo causó mortalidad baja, marginalmente significativa. Ambos aceites en combinación con C. farinosa produjeron efectos antagónicos, en comparación con el hongo solo. La combinación de C. farinosa con spinosad resultó en una mayor mortalidad de insectos (20% y más) en comparación con los agentes separados. Nuestros resultados indican que el spinosad (un insecticida de alto precio) debe probarse en cantidades reducidas, combinado con C. farinosa o posiblemente con otros hongos entomopatógenos, para el control de la chinche pintada.
